The Stichting Waternet wishes to conduct a practical test of an ecosystem approach to control crayfish, based on the model by Kleef et al. (2022). The test will take place in a compartment of approximately 2 ha, while measures will be deployed on a larger scale in the 50 ha large water level area Molenpolder Natuurreservaat. This allows an intensive approach to be compared with a less intensive variant. Waternet retains control and divides the work into lots: one part will be carried out internally, while another part will be realized by a selected market party through a lot scheme. A detailed Program of Requirements has been drawn up for each lot. The assignment is an open procedure for services, aimed at testing, evaluating, and implementing a sustainable, affordable approach for the management of crayfish.
